The Indirect Tax Tool (ITT) extends the scope of EUROMOD simulations, allowing for the simulation of consumption taxes, inflation analysis and price-side measures.

Consumption taxes are a crucial revenue source for EU governments and an effective tool to promote healthier and sustainable choices. Our unit analyzes and supports evidence-based policy to ensure fairness and effectiveness in tax systems.

We provide ex-ante assessments of the expected distributive and budgetary effects of green taxation reforms, as well as potential compensatory measures for the promotion of a fair transition.

We assess the fiscal and distributional impacts of policy interventions, introduced in many EU countries from 2022 onward, in mitigating the effects of energy price hikes.

We support the efforts to monitor and tackle the Energy poverty by analysing energy poverty indicators and profiling vulnerable households to improve policy targeting.

We incorporated household Green House Gas footprints to our microsimulation toolbox to expand the scope of green policies we can assess (for example: carbon taxes).
